Marie-Françoise BERTOURNE (BETOURNAY) was born 29 May 1694 in Montréal, Canada, New France

Marie-Françoise BERTOURNE (BETOURNAY) was the child of Pierre BETOURNE (BETOURNAY)   and   Jeanne-Françoise RONCERAY and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Adrien (André) BERTOURNE (BETOURNAY) dit LAVIOLETTE and Marie DESHAYES (maternal)  Jean RONCERAY dit LEBRETON and Jeanne SERVIGNAN

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Marie-Françoise  married  Antoine CAILLÉ dit BISCORNET 27 April 1717 in La Prairie, Canada, New France .  The couple had (at least) 6 children.
Antoine CAILLÉ dit BISCORNET  was born 23 March 1683 in La Prairie, Québec, Canada (St-Philippe) (St-Jean-François-Régis) (La Nativité).  Antoine died 22 January 1749 in La Prairie, Québec, Canada (St-Philippe) (St-Jean-François-Régis) (La Nativité).  Antoine was the child of Antoine CAILLÉ dit BISCORNET BRÛLEFER and Anne AUBRY.

Marie-Françoise BERTOURNE (BETOURNAY) died 27 April 1754 in La Prairie, Canada, New France .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
